San Juan (SJG) Geomagnetic Observatory

The San Juan observatory sign.

Station Id: SJG
Location: Cayey, PR
Latitude: 18.11°N
Longitude: 66.15°W
Elevation: 424 meters
Orientation: HDZF

Sections

Background

The Geomagnetism Program has operated an observatory at Puerto Rico since 1903. The current observatory site, consisting of 36 acres in the mountains near Cayey, has been in use since 1965.
